Mold has a way of sneaking into the pores of a building and often times, cleaning departments are caught off guard. Cleaning managers are often the first to identify whether mold is a problem within a facility. This is why it is important to understand the steps necessary to prevent the introduction and spread of mold and the safety concerns associated with cleaning after an outbreak.
